The Purdue Boilermakers finished the 2011 season with a 7-6 record and a 4-4 record in the Big Ten Conference. Purdue returns 19 starters from a season ago, including quarterback Caleb Terbush who threw for 1,905 yards and 13 touchdowns.
Purdue opens the non-conference portion of its schedule with games against Eastern Kentucky, Notre Dame, Eastern Michigan and Marshall before opening Big Ten play against Michigan on October 6. Notable conference games for the Boilermakers include Wisconsin, Ohio State, Penn State, Iowa, Illinois and Indiana.
